What is the theme behind NYT Strands game #866?

Today's NYT Strands puzzle revolves around the theme "Categorically speaking." This means the answers are tied to well-known categories, specifically related to segments found in a popular trivia board game. Understanding this framework helps narrow down potential answers by focusing on category names.

What should you know about the spangram in this puzzle?

A key to completing each NYT Strands game is uncovering the spangram—a word using all the puzzle’s important letters. For game #866, the spangram contains 14 letters, spanning the entire fourth row from the left edge to the right edge of the board. Identifying this long word can unlock all the letters and assist in filling out the categories.

The answers for this game reflect the classic category wedges of a well-known trivia game:

  • ENTERTAINMENT
  • NATURE
  • SPORTS
  • GEOGRAPHY
  • Spangram: TRIVIALPURSUIT

Notably, the categories HISTORY and SCIENCE aren’t included in this puzzle, focusing instead on four of the six typical segments. Recognizing this link between the puzzle and the trivia game helps make educated guesses and clarifies the game’s categorical approach.
